Hioki 3197 Power Quality Analyzer
The Hioki 3197 Power Quality Analyzer is a high-performance instrument designed for precise measurement and analysis of electrical power systems. Engineered for both industrial and utility applications, it provides accurate insights into power quality, energy consumption, and electrical network health. Its advanced features enable engineers, technicians, and maintenance professionals to detect anomalies, optimize energy efficiency, and ensure reliable operation of electrical equipment.
Equipped with multiple input channels, the Hioki 3197 supports simultaneous measurement of voltage, current, and power parameters, including harmonic analysis up to high orders. The analyzer features an intuitive interface with a clear LCD display and user-friendly software for real-time monitoring and data logging. Its compact and rugged design allows for easy deployment in field or laboratory environments.
Key functionalities include waveform capture, transient detection, and detailed analysis of power factor, voltage unbalance, and harmonic distortion. The device is ideal for troubleshooting electrical disturbances, verifying compliance with power quality standards, and performing energy audits to improve system efficiency.
With robust data storage, flexible reporting, and connectivity options, the Hioki 3197 Power Quality Analyzer delivers reliable performance for both short-term diagnostics and long-term monitoring, making it an essential tool for power quality management and electrical system optimization.
Specifications
General / Basic Specs
-
Model: Hioki 3197 Power Quality Analyzer
-
Measurement Line Types: Single-phase 2-wire, Single-phase 3-wire, Three-phase 3-wire, Three-phase 4-wire
-
Measurement Line Frequency: Auto-detect (50 Hz / 60 Hz)
-
Voltage Range: 600 V AC
-
Current Range: 500 mA to 5 000 A AC (depends on clamp sensor used)
-
Power Range: Approx. 300 W to 9.00 MW (depends on current range & line type)
-
Accuracy:
-
Voltage: ±0.3 % reading ±0.2 % full scale
-
Current: ±0.3 % reading ±0.2 % full scale + sensor accuracy
-
Active Power: ±0.3 % reading ±0.2 % full scale + sensor accuracy (PF=1)
-
Measurements & Analysis Functions
Power & Energy:
-
RMS Voltage & Current
-
Frequency
-
Active / Reactive / Apparent Power
-
Power Factor / Displacement Power Factor
-
Active & Reactive Energy
Quality & Disturbances:
-
Voltage Swells (Rise)
-
Voltage Dips (Drop)
-
Voltage Interruptions
-
Inrush Current Detection
-
Transient Overvoltage (≥50 Vrms, 10–100 kHz)
Harmonics & Other Metrics:
-
Harmonic Analysis up to 50th order
-
Total Harmonic Voltage Distortion (THD-V)
-
Total Harmonic Current Distortion (THD-I)
-
Voltage Unbalance Factor
-
K-Factor (for transformer heating)
Recording & Memory
-
Internal Memory: 4 MB non-volatile
-
Maximum Recording Time: Up to approx. 125 days (depends on interval settings & parameters)
-
Interval Logging: AUTO, 1 min, 5 min, 15 min, 30 min, 60 min
-
Recordable Items: All measured parameters including max/min/average values
Interface & Display
-
Display: 4.7-inch color STN LCD
-
PC Interface: USB 2.0 for communication & data transfer
-
Software: PC application for analysis and report generation
Power & Physical
-
Power Supply: AC Adapter (100–240 V) or Rechargeable Battery Pack (~6 hr runtime)
-
Operating Environment: Indoor use, 0 °C to 40 °C
-
Dimensions: 128 mm W × 246 mm H × 63 mm D
-
Weight: Approx. 1.2 kg (with battery)
